The Commonwealth of Massachusetts William Francis Galvin, Secretary of the Commonwealth Public Records Division Manza Arthur Supervisor of Records October 21, 2025 SPR25/2974 Arthur Motta Records Access officer New Bedford Public Schools 455 County Street, Room 101 New Bedford, MA 02740 Dear Mr. Motta: I have received the petition of Collin Dias appealing the nonresponse of New Bedford Public Schools (School) to a request for public records. See G. L. c. 66, § 10A; see also 950 C.M.R. 32.08(1). On September 9, 2025, Mr. Dias requested the following records between the dates January 1, 2025 and September 8, 2025: [1] Any text messages to and from New Bedford High School Principal . . . stored in any cell phone operated by . . . (either work or private) that contain the following key words: [1] Collin[;] [2] Colin[;] [3] Dias[;] [4] Fall River[;] [5] School Committee[;] [6] School Board[;] [7] SC[;] [2] Any text messages to and from New Bedford High School Principal Joyce Cardoza [operated by Joyce Cardoza (either work or private)] and the following people: [1] [identified individual] [and 2] [identified individual;] [3] Any emails to and from New Bedford High School Principal . . . and any email that ends in @fallriverschool.org[.] Claiming to not yet have received responsive records, Mr. Dias petitioned this office and this appeal, SPR25/2974, was opened as a result. Arthur Motta SPR25/2974 Page 2 October 21, 2025 Despite being notified of the opening of this appeal, it remains unclear whether the School has provided a response. Accordingly, the School is ordered to provide Mr. Dias with a response to his request, provided in a manner consistent with this order, the Public Records Law and its Regulations within ten (10) business days. A copy of any such response must be provided to this office. It is preferable to send an electronic copy of the response to this office at pre@sec.state.ma.us. Mr. Dias may appeal the substantive nature of the School’s response within ninety (90) days. See 950 C.M.R. 32.08(1). Sincerely, Manza Arthur Supervisor of Records cc: Collin Dias
